11th Annual Hot Cocoa Race sponsored by Sylvania Prevention Alliance
A great family event that will help chase away the winter blues!
Our Hot Cocoa 10K/5K/1Mile Race is being held in partnership with Olander Park. The race starts at 9am and there will be multiple corals for a safe start. In addition to the 5K and 10K, we are having a 1 mile race for our elementary age runners.
The 1 Mile Race or Walk will be the 1 mile loop around Olander Lake. We are offering a 1 mile timed race for kids and a 1 mile timed event for adults. (Whether you race or walk, you will get a time) The 1 mile course will stay in Olander park and go around the beautiful lake.
The 5K Race will start at the Nederhouser Community Building, run south on the trail, exit out of Olander Park, cross Sylvania Ave into Farmbrook neighborhood, run onto the university parks trail to McCord Rd, head north on McCord to Sylvania Ave to Olander, and then circle the lake to finish in Olander Park at the Neiderhouser. The 10K will follow the same course, but continue onto the University Parks trail, before coming back to the 5K course to finish. The courses are open to traffic and not a closed course. (Maps will be provided online and at packet pick-up)
Proceeds will go toward our youth programs for promoting positive, healthy lifestyle choices and the prevention of drug, alcohol use and other at-risk behaviors in our community. Sylvania Prevention Alliance provides programs that offer guidance and education and sponsors positive events that develop leadership and team building skills.
Hot Cocoa and grab and go snacks will be available after the race finish.
Age group awards will be awarded after the conclusion of the races.

The RELAY CHALLENGE is a community event for 6-12 grade students of Sylvania and Sylvania Township to participate in a unique and memorable experience. The Relay will include as many as 20 teams, made up of ten (10) members each. Each participant will run or walk at least one mile at a time, then pass the timing chip to the next member, and so on. This process will continue for the entire event.
While the teams are circling the track, there will be continuous activities, entertainment, and food -- plus a chance to meet others who choose a healthy lifestyle. Without a doubt, it will definitely be hours of memorable fun for everyone

Looking to run your first 5K? With Dave's Beginner 5K program, you have a detailed plan that mixes walking and running together until you are out there running 3.1 miles on your own.
If you are someone who prefers to run-walk, we have a half-marathon plan with coaches who train using a run-walk training method for the half-marathon distance. This "open pace" training plan is also used for anyone looking to complete their first marathon, and goal time is not a factor.
